A few months ago, Flint City Hall was investigated by the FBI and it looks like it's been an ongoing project. According to ABC-12, funding for $1.3 million in federal grants for the city of Flint has been suspended by the Department of Energy as they continue to investigate some of the funds and what they've been used for.

Flint isn't the only city being checked  and this is a way for the department to review how the city has been used the grant money. Mayor Dayne Walling had to turn over personnel files and they wanted information from April 2009, which was months before Walling took office.

The mayor also said in a press conference that his department is also doing their own investigation. In the meantime, grand funding has been temporarily suspended and no other details have been released.
